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 25 mins
Total Time: 40 mins
Cuisine: Mediterranean
Serves: 4 servings
Ingredients
- 8 ounces pasta
- 1 zucchini, sliced
- 1 bell pepper, chopped
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 4 ounces goat cheese
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h basil for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per to prevent sticking and ease cleanup.
- Wash and prepare the vegetables: slice zucchini into half-moon shapes, chop bell pepper into roughly 1-inch pieces, and halve the cherry tomatoes. Spread the vegetables evenly on the prepared baking sheet.
- Drizzle olive oil over the vegetables, then season generously with salt and freshly ground black pepper. Toss the vegetables to ensure they are evenly coated with oil and seasoning.
- Roast the vegetables in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es, stirring once halfway through, until they are tender and have slight caramelization on the edges.
- While vegetables are roasting, bring a large pot of salted water to a rolling boil. Add p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ente, typically 8-10 minutes.
- Reserve 1/2 cup of pasta cooking water before draining the pasta. This starchy water will help create a creamy sauce later.
- Return the drained pasta to the pot. Add roasted vegetables and crumble goat cheese over the top. Gently toss to combine, using reserved pasta water to help melt the cheese and create a light sauce.
- Taste and ad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per if needed.
- Serve immediately in warm bowls, garnishing with fresh torn basil leaves. Optionally, drizzle with a little extra olive oil for added richness.
Tips
- For maximum flavor, choose high-quality goat cheese and fresh vegetables. The quality of ingredients can dramatically elevate this dish.
- Don't skip reserving pasta water! The starchy liquid is crucial for creating a silky, smooth sauce that helps the cheese melt perfectly.
- Cut vegetables into similar-sized pieces to ensure even roasting. This guarantees each bite has consistent texture and caramelization.
- For extra depth of flavor, consider adding a pinch of red pepper flakes or a drizzle of balsamic glaze before serving.
- If you prefer a lighter version, you can use whole wheat pasta or substitute zucchini noodles for a lower-carb alternative.
- Fresh basil is key - add it just before serving to maintain its vibrant color and aromatic flavor.
